Linux数据库高效配置与运行保障实战指南

在Linux环境下配置数据库时,选择合适的数据库系统是关键。常见的如MySQL、PostgreSQL和MariaDB等,各有其特点和适用场景。根据业务需求选择合适的数据库,并确保其版本与Linux发行版兼容。

安装数据库前,建议更新系统软件包并安装必要的依赖库。使用apt、yum或dnf等工具可以简化安装流程。同时,配置防火墙规则以允许数据库服务端口,保障数据传输安全。

AI方案图,仅供参考

数据库的性能优化可以从配置文件入手。例如,调整MySQL的my.cnf或PostgreSQL的postgresql.conf中的缓存大小、连接数限制等参数,能显著提升响应速度。但需根据服务器硬件资源合理设置。

定期备份是保障数据安全的重要措施。可利用数据库自带的备份工具,如mysqldump或pg_dump,结合cron定时任务实现自动化备份。备份文件应存储在安全的位置,并定期验证恢复流程。

监控数据库运行状态有助于及时发现潜在问题。使用top、htop、iostat等命令监控系统资源,或通过数据库内置的监控工具分析查询性能。日志文件也是排查问题的重要依据。

•保持数据库及操作系统补丁更新,防范已知漏洞。同时,设置强密码策略和访问控制,避免未授权访问。这些措施共同构建起数据库的高效运行与安全保障体系。

dawei

【声明】:丽水站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复